President of Ukraine Petro Poroshenko had a telephone call with Prime Minister of Canada Justin Trudeau.
President Poroshenko informed of the open act of aggression committed by Russia against Ukrainian ships in the Kerch Strait, an increase in the number of Russian military equipment at the border and the steps taken by Ukraine to de-escalate Russian aggression, including the introduction of martial law.
Prime Minister Trudeau emphasized that Canada fully supported Ukraine, its territorial integrity, freedom of navigation and condemns the aggressive actions of Russia.
The President of Ukraine urged the civilized world to increase pressure on Russia to release Ukrainian sailors who are considered prisoners of war by international law.
The interlocutors also coordinated positions on the protection of Ukraine on the eve of the G20 Summit, which will be held in Buenos Aires.
